Hotel Naming Tips

Keep Hotel Names Memorable

A memorable name is crucial for hotel businesses. Choose names that are easy to recall and spell, as customers will need to find you online and in directories. Short, punchy names often work best.

Consider Industry Keywords

While not always necessary, incorporating relevant keywords can help with SEO and immediate clarity. For hotel businesses, consider subtle references to your core services or values.

Test Domain Availability

Before finalizing your hotel name, check domain availability. The .com extension is still most trusted, but .co, .io, or industry-specific extensions can work well if .com isn't available.

Think Long-Term

Your hotel business might evolve over time. Choose a name that's flexible enough to grow with you, rather than one that's too specific to your current offerings.

Get Feedback

Test your hotel name ideas with potential customers, partners, and advisors. What sounds good to you might not resonate with your target audience.
